Ratio- what is it? Remember that a ratio shows the relationship between two or more values and describes how one is related to another.

Proportion- what is it? Proportion is looking at the TOTAL amount of objects, and seeing what amount of each “thing” you have. This is where the fractions come into play.

How to write the ratio For every 4 red apples, there are 2 yellow bananas. The ratio of apples to bananas is 4: 2 BUT this can be simplified to 2: 1
